About this listen

Join us on a fascinating journey as we delve into the early academic expedition to Australia from 1880 to 1883, led by an author with a unique perspective. Unlike many of his contemporaries, who focused solely on the superficial aspects of indigenous life, he took a deeper dive into the social, economic, and anthropological dimensions of the indigenous peoples. This captivating narrative not only chronicles zoological phenomena but also paints a rich picture of cultural interactions and insights that remain relevant today.
